We waited until today to send out a message because we thought you may be interested to hear the auction results. Thank you to each and every family who contributed their time and/or financial resources to make our one fundraiser of the year so successful!
Here are some of the stats for this year: Attendees: 194 Workers evening-of: 40ish Live auction: $10,037 Silent Auction: $19,683 Class Projects: $1,185 Donations for Washington D.C. trip: $5125 When all is totaled and expenses considered, we netted over $35,000 for ICA!
